    So, just got home from my local NAPA store to purchase a belt and tensioner pully for my 97 Grand Prix GT.
    Dave (guy behind the counter) asked me if it is the 1st design or 2nd design? I have no clue. I asked what the difference in belt length is from 1st to 2nd. One uses a 93 and 5/8 inch belt, and the other is a 94" belt...... 3/8 of a freakin inch difference...

    Anyone have any clue how to tell if you have a 1st design or a 2nd design?

    The cost difference in the belts is $20 freakin dollars.... for 3/8 difference.
